td.maincontent td.rightcolumn {padding-right: 5px; *padding-right: 0px;}
td.newsroom_2cols p.bodytext {font-family: Calibri; font-size: 14px;} 


table.contenttable td.tb_head {
  background-color: #7999BF;
}

table.contenttable td.tb_head p.bodytext {
  color: #ffffff;
  font-weight: bold;
}

table.contenttable td.tb_body1, table.contenttable td.tb_body {
  background-color: #f0f0f0;
}

td.maincontent h1.csc-firstHeader {
  color:#222222;
  font-size:1.2em;
  font-weight:normal;
  margin-bottom:0px;
  margin-top:0px;
}

td.maincontent h4 {
  color:#222222;
  font-size:1.0em;
  font-weight:bold;
  margin-bottom:0px;
  margin-top:0px;
}

td.maincontent h5 {
  padding: 5px;
  background-color: #f0f0f0;
  border: 1px solid #999999;
  color:#222222;
  font-size:0.8em;
  font-weight:bold;
}

td.maincontent div#c146845 h5 {margin: 5px 45px 5px 30px !important;}

td.newsroom_2cols h6 {
  color:#000000;
  font-family:Arial;
  font-size:0.7em;
  line-height: 1.6em;
  font-weight:normal;
  margin-top:10px;
  padding-top:10px;
  letter-spacing: 1px;
  border-top: 1px dotted #666666; 
}

div.tx-dynalist-pi1 table td {
  background-color:#F1F0ED;
  border:0;
}

div.tx-dynalist-pi1 table tr.table-title td {
  text-align:center;
  font-weight:bold;
  background-color:#CCCCCC;
}

div.tx-dynalist-pi1-pagination {
  margin:15px 0 0 0;
  border:0;
  text-align:center;
  border-top: 1px dashed #CECFCE;
  padding-top: 10px;
}

div.tx-dynalist-pi1-pagination span.paginate {text-transform: normal; font-size: 11px;}
div.tx-dynalist-pi1-pagination select.paginate {margin-left: 3px;}

div.tx-dynalist-pi1-pagination a.paginate {border:1px solid #999999;}

div.tx-dynalist-pi1-pagination a.current, div.tx-dynalist-pi1 a.paginate:hover {
  background:none repeat scroll 0 0 #7B9EC6;
  border:1px solid #999999;
  color:#ffffff;
}

td.newsroom_2cols a, td.newsroom_2cols a:hover {color:#3B6CA9;}




/* ########################## multicontent ########################################## */ 

div#c120805 .ui-accordion .ui-accordion-header a {padding:4px; padding-left:27px; font-size: 12px;}
div#c120805 .ui-state-default, div#c120805 .ui-widget-content .ui-state-default, div#c120805 .ui-widget-header .ui-state-default {background: none; border: none;}
div#c120805.ui-state-active, div#c120805 .ui-widget-content .ui-state-active, div#c120805 .ui-widget-header .ui-state-active {background: none; border: none;}
div#c120805 h1.csc-firstHeader {display: none;}
div#c120805 .ui-widget-content {background:none; border:none; padding-top: 0px; padding-left: 28px;}

.ui-state-active, .ui-widget-content .ui-state-active, .ui-widget-header .ui-state-active {border: none;}

div#c130115 div.tx-jfmulticontent-pi1 {
  margin-top:20px;
}

div#c130115 div.tx-jfmulticontent-pi1 h2 {
  text-align:center;
  margin-bottom:5px;
}





 /* TO BE REMOVED ONCE THE SITE WILL BE PUBLISHED */

p.bodytext {font-size: 15px; font-family: Calibri;}

div#c146473 li a {font-size: 16px; font-family: Calibri;}

td.newsroom_2cols div.tx-jfmulticontent-pi1 h6 {border-top: 1px solid #AFBF85; color: #000000;  font-family: calibri; font-size: 15px; font-weight: bold; letter-spacing: 0; line-height: 1.6em; padding-top: 0px; margin-top: 20px;}


/* ###############################################  right column ########################################################### */


#box_blue_2cols h1.csc-firstHeader, #box_blue_2cols h1 {border-top: none; padding: 0px 5px; font-family: Calibri; font-size: 13px; margin: 0px; color: #333333; font-weight: bold;}
#box_blue_2cols .csc-default {margin-bottom: 15px; background-color: #ffffff;}
/* #box_blue_2cols .csc-default .csc-header {background-color: #5079AC;} */

#box_blue_2cols div.right_box, #box_blue_2cols div.csc-default  {
    background-color: #F5F5F5;
    border-color: #E7E7E7 #999999 #999999 #E7E7E7;
    border-style: solid;
    border-width: 1px;
    font-family: Arial,Helvetica,sans-serif;
    font-size: 11px;
    margin: -5px 2px 15px;
    padding-bottom: 5px;
}

#box_blue_2cols div.rx_green div.csc-header {background-color: #607F0C;}
#box_blue_2cols div.rx_blue div.csc-header {background-color: #0861AF;}
#box_blue_2cols div.rx_violet div.csc-header {background-color: #443584;}
#box_blue_2cols div.rx_orange div.csc-header {background-color: #BF7901;}
#box_blue_2cols div.rx_gray div.csc-header {background-color: #999999;}

#box_blue_2cols div.csc-header {
    background-color: #5079AC;
    color: #FFFFFF;
    font-family: Arial,Helvetica,sans-serif;
    font-size: 12px;
    font-weight: bold;
    padding: 3px 2px 2px 4px;
    *padding-top: 3px;
}

#box_blue_2cols div.csc-header h1 {color: #ffffff; padding-top: 0px; font-size: 15px; text-transform: uppercase;}

td.maincontent td.rightcolumn table.table_menu_right {margin-top: 40px;}
table.table_menu_right td#box_blue_2cols p.bodytext {font-size: 14px; color: #000000; font-family: Calibri;}
table.table_menu_right td#box_blue_2cols p.bodytext a {font-size: 14px; font-weight: bold; color: #3B6CC7; font-family: Calibri;}

table.table_menu_right td#box_blue_2cols ul {padding-left: 5px; padding-right: 5px; margin-top: 8px; *margin-top: 3px;}
table.table_menu_right td#box_blue_2cols ul li {
    background: url("http://www.fao.org/fileadmin/templates/employment/images/small_arrow.png") no-repeat scroll transparent;
    *background: url("http://www.fao.org/fileadmin/templates/employment/images/small_arrow.png") no-repeat scroll left 4px transparent;
    border-bottom: none; 
    padding-left: 18px;
    padding-bottom: 0px;
    margin-bottom: 0px;
   /*  font-family: Calibri;
   font-size: 13px; */
    font-size: 12px; 
}
table.table_menu_right td#box_blue_2cols ul li a {font-weight: bold; color: #3B6CC7; /*font-family: Calibri; font-size: 13px; */}

/* _________ S H A R E ______ */
#box_blue_2cols div#c146470, #box_blue_2cols div#c146528, #box_blue_2cols div#c146839, #box_blue_2cols div#c146853, #box_blue_2cols div#c146956 {background: #fff; border: none; margin-top: 25px; margin-left: 32px;}

/* ################################################################################## */

div.anythingControls {display:none !important; }

td#box_blue_2cols div#c130478 {background: none; border: none;}

div.lof-description {display: none !important;}
.lof-slider_1 .lof-css3 .lof-navigator-wapper {box-shadow: none;}
.lof-slider_1 .lof-navigator li img, .lof-slider_1 .lof-navigator li.active img, .lof-slider_1 .lof-navigator li:hover img {border:1px solid #000;}
